Noun: cactus family  'kak-tus 'fa-mu-lee
  1. The botanical family of cacti, comprising succulent plants typically having thick fleshy stems, spines, and showy flowers; constitutes the order Opuntiales
    "The cactus family includes thousands of drought-resistant species";
    - Cactaceae, family Cactaceae

Derived forms: cactus families

Type of: caryophylloid dicot family

Part of: Opuntiales, order Opuntiales
